分段函数switch的应用

来源:互联网 发布:淘宝上的深海泥有用吗 编辑:程序博客网 时间:2024/04/29 09:50
#include <iostream>#include<cmath>using namespace std;int main(){    double x,y;    int t;    cout<<"请输入x的值:";    cin>>x;    t=(x<2)+(x<6)+(x<10);    switch(t)    {        case 3:y=x;break;        case 2:y=x*x+1;break;        case 1:y=sqrt(x+1);break;        case 0:y=1.0/(x+1);break;    }    cout<<"得到y的值为:"<<y<<endl;    return 0;}

0 0
原创粉丝点击